Soccer News: Allegri thinks about the matches ahead of Milan: ´This match is more important for them´

0

Massimiliano Allegri says Sunday’s Serie A clash between Juventus and AC Milan is more important for the Rossoneri despite overseeing a poor start to 2021-22.

Allegri has three league games in his second spell in Turin, but there has been no sign of a honeymoon period, with Juve not winning any of those games yet.

They eased some pressure with a 3-0 Champions League win on Tuesday, although the goodwill of that win will only last so long as it was against Malmo.

Failure on Sunday will leave Juve winless in their first four Serie A matches in a single season for the fourth time, the last time in 1961-62.

On the contrary, AC Milan – which this season are in the Champions League for the first time since 2013-14 – have won all three Serie A games in 2021-22, with Stefano Pioli’s men second only to Roma by difference. networks.

Despite the different beginnings of the season, Allegri insists that Sunday’s match is a more important deal for Milan than Juve, and he also wanted to emphasize that there is no reason to panic over their title hopes if Pioli’s team will start with a positive result.

“Tomorrow’s game is more important to them than to us,” Allegri told reporters, even though he would not openly explain why he felt that way. “That’s what you have to say, otherwise I’ll help you too much.”

On the title race he added: “I think there is no team that can crush the championship. Maybe I’m wrong.

“You can lose points, but you can also recover them quickly. We must not think that if we lose we will be 11 points behind, we must work thinking about recovering the ground we lost at the beginning.

“I’ve always said that championships are won against smaller teams. We don’t know what tomorrow’s result will be because the devil invented football: you can play well and in any case maybe you lose or draw.

“It’s not that before Malmö we had become poor drunkards and now we’re phenomenal again. We need balance. You have to work and have the ambition to win.

“I have to be a coach, because the team goes on the pitch, but I also have to hammer on the psychological aspect because Juve is a team that has to play not to win games, but to win championships.

“They win all the games, all the teams, but the championship will only be won by one. In the end, the team that was the best will win the championship ”.

Allegri’s return after a two-year absence has understandably evoked memories of Juventus’ extraordinary run of nine consecutive Scudetti, with the 54-year-old in charge for five of them.

But he believes that comparisons between the two teams and the two distinctly different eras are not useful.

“I found a Juventus with different players,” he continued. “We shouldn’t think about comparing Juve today with what they were in the past.

“This team has its own identity and individual characteristics of the players. You have to become a team by improving many things, in terms of personality, technique and patience in the game. But it’s just a different Juve. “

In a potential blow for Juve, Allegri confirmed that Federico Chiesa is in doubt for Sunday’s match.

The Italian international was involved in six goals against Milan in Serie A, a tally that has improved against no other team.

He also scored his only double for Juventus in the Italian top flight against the Rossoneri in January.
